Course Content

• Introduction to Jungian Psychology and the Shadow Self
• Exploring the Shadow: Archetypes, Complexes, and Projections
• Dreamwork and Active Imagination in Shadow Integration
• Shadow Work Techniques: Self-Reflection, Journaling, and Mindfulness
• Integrating the Shadow: Personal Growth and Transformation
• The Shadow in Relationships: Dynamics of Power and Connection
• Shadow and Spirituality: Confronting the Darker Aspects of the Self
• Jungian Shadow Work and Creativity: Unleashing the Unconscious
• Ethical Considerations in Shadow Work Practice
• Case Studies in Jungian Shadow Work: Analysis and Application

Key facts about Graduate Certificate in Jungian Shadow Work

```html

A Graduate Certificate in Jungian Shadow Work offers specialized training in depth psychology, focusing on the integration of the unconscious self. This program equips students with the knowledge and skills to understand and work with the shadow aspects of the psyche, a core concept in Jungian psychology.


Learning outcomes typically include a deep understanding of Jungian theory and its application to shadow work, proficiency in analytical techniques such as dream analysis and active imagination, and the development of ethical and responsible practices for working with clients exploring their shadow selves. Students will gain a nuanced perspective on archetypes, complexes, and individuation.
